Method of Manufacture
(1)JIS G3456 STPT 410 Carbon Steel Pipes are manufactured from coarse-grained killed steel by the seamless or electric resistance welding process
(2)When required by the purchaser, the pipe may be furnished with the bevel end.
Heat treatment
| Grade | Hot finished seamless steel pipe | Cold finished seamless steel pipe | Hot finished electric resistance welded steel pipe | Electric resistance welded steel pipe other than hot finished |
| STPT410 | As manufactured. However, low temperature annealing or normalizing may be applied, as necessary. | Low temperature annealed or normalized. | As manufactured. However, low temperature annealing or normalizing may be applied, as necessary. | Low temperature annealed or normalized. |
Chemical Composition of JIS G3456 STPT 410
| Grade | Chemical Composition % | ||||
| C | Si | Mn | p | S | |
| STPT 410 | 0.30 max. | 0.10~0.35 | 0.30~1.00 | 0.035 max. | 0.035 max. |
Mechanical Properties of JIS G3456 STPT 410
| Letter symbol of grade | Mechanical Properties | |||||
| Tensile strength | Yield strength | Elongation % | ||||
| kgf/m㎡ {N/ m㎡} | kgf/m㎡ {N/ m㎡} | No.11 and No.12 test pieces | No. 5 test pieces | No. 4 test piece | ||
| Longitudinal | Transverse | Longitudinal | Transverse | |||
| STPT 410 | 42{412}min | 25{245} min | 25 min | 20 min | 19 min | 24 min |
Appearance
(1)The pipe are practically straight, and its both ends shall be at a right angle to its axis.
(2) The inside and outside surfaces of the pipe shall be well-finished and free form defects that are detrimental to practical use.
Dimensions Tolerance of JIS G3456
| Division | Tolerances on outside diameter | Tolerances on wall thickness | Tolerance on deviation in wall thickness |
| Hot finished seamless steel pipe | Up to 50 mm 【0.5mm | ≤Up to 4 mm 【0.5mm | Up to and incl. 20 % of wall thickness |
| 50mm and over, up to 160mm 【1% | |||
| 160mm and over, up to 200mm 【1.6mm | ≤4mm and over 【12.5% | ||
| 200mm and over 【0.8% | |||
| However, for pipes 350mm and over in diameter, the length of circumference may substitute as a basis for tolerances, In this case, the tolerances shall be 【0.5%. | |||
| Cold finished seamless steel pipe and electric resistance welded steel pipe | Up to 40mm 【0.3mm | ≤Up to 2 mm 【0.2mm | – |
| 40mm and over 【0.8% | ≤2mm and over 【10% | ||
| However, for pipes 350mm and over in diameter, the length of circumference may substitute as a basis for tolerances. In this case, the tolerances shall be 【0.5% |
